IP查询
查询
你查询的IP:[59.155.71.26] 地理位置:中国–上海–上海电信
最新查询
125.216.21.162
203.86.104.17
221.68.126.237
202.112.80.133
121.76.174.172
120.48.57.249
203.208.237.33
124.224.168.223
119.16.162.77
59.155.71.26
202.127.12.243
116.89.144.26
119.48.19.250
58.66.6.20
124.20.9.29
123.100.65.165
161.207.99.180
203.176.168.252
218.108.238.242
59.191.240.34
120.80.181.163
203.171.224.87
202.165.208.166
202.91.42.169
210.5.144.120
118.126.153.250
202.38.150.210
122.240.62.46
119.144.42.155
221.8.65.49
222.176.31.81